Exploring the Connection Between Fraud Prevention Measures and Debit Card Security:
Several key factors influence the effectiveness of debit card fraud prevention measures:
Roles and Real-World Examples:
- Zero Liability Policies: Many banks offer zero-liability policies, protecting consumers from fraudulent charges if they report them promptly. However, this doesn't apply to all situations (e.g., if the cardholder contributed to the fraud).
- EMV Chip Cards: The adoption of EMV (Europay, MasterCard, and Visa) chip cards has significantly reduced card-present fraud. Chip cards encrypt transaction data, making it much harder for skimmers to steal information.
- Two-Factor Authentication: Adding an extra layer of security, such as a one-time password (OTP) sent to a mobile phone, can significantly enhance online transaction security.
Risks and Mitigations:
- Phishing Scams: Fraudsters often use phishing emails or text messages to trick users into revealing their card details. Mitigation involves being wary of suspicious communications and verifying the legitimacy of websites before entering sensitive information.
- Malware: Malicious software can secretly steal card information from computers and mobile devices. Regular updates of antivirus software and careful browsing habits are crucial preventative measures.
- Skimming: Skimmers attached to ATMs or POS terminals can clone card information. Regularly checking ATMs for suspicious devices and choosing reputable merchants can minimize this risk.

Further Analysis: Examining Liability Limits in Greater Detail:
The Electronic Funds Transfer Act (EFTA) sets limits on a consumer's liability for unauthorized debit card transactions. Generally, if a card is reported lost or stolen, the consumer's liability is limited to $50. However, this limit can increase if the fraud is not reported promptly. Understanding these liability limits and the reporting requirements is crucial for minimizing financial exposure.
FAQ Section: Answering Common Questions About Debit Card Fraud Protection:
- What is zero liability? Zero liability policies offered by many banks protect consumers from fraudulent charges if they report them promptly. The specific terms and conditions vary by bank.
- How can I protect myself from online debit card fraud? Use strong passwords, avoid public Wi-Fi for sensitive transactions, and look for secure website indicators (https).
- What should I do if I suspect debit card fraud? Contact your bank immediately to report the fraudulent activity and take steps to secure your account.
- Are debit cards safer than credit cards? Both debit and credit cards have their own security features and vulnerabilities. Credit cards often offer better fraud protection due to liability limitations and dispute resolution processes. However, debit cards directly access your bank account, making the impact of fraud potentially more severe.
- What are some common signs of debit card fraud? Unexplained transactions on your account statement, unauthorized online access, or physical card theft are all warning signs.
Practical Tips: Maximizing the Benefits of Debit Card Fraud Protection:
- Monitor your account regularly: Review your online banking statements frequently to detect any suspicious activity.
- Use strong and unique passwords: Choose strong, complex passwords for online banking and avoid reusing passwords across multiple accounts.
- Enable transaction alerts: Set up email or text alerts to receive notifications of every transaction made on your debit card.
- Be cautious about phishing scams: Never click on links in suspicious emails or text messages.
- Use secure Wi-Fi: Avoid using public Wi-Fi to access online banking or make online purchases.
- Protect your card physically: Keep your debit card in a safe place and don't share your PIN with anyone.
- Report fraud immediately: If you suspect fraudulent activity, report it to your bank immediately.
